Output e3c04ee04eef04e581ea3c4cde3be42be0e57501bffc003722058ee8ad1bfdb3:2

value
11342614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c76c9378e81c6c33b561e009875d007a9b97ae5 OP_EQUAL
address
3FxKds9xLbNgjAWtXfTg1yPdEXKEx8UjiQ
transaction
e3c04ee04eef04e581ea3c4cde3be42be0e57501bffc003722058ee8ad1bfdb3
spent
true